![]() |
![]() ![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 384 Pomógł: 13 Dołączył: 16.06.2006 Ostrzeżenie: (0%) ![]() ![]() |
Witam. Mam pewien skrypt którego niestety nie mogę udostępnić więc potrzebuje jedynie porad ogólnych. Przy sprawdzaniu ile pożera pamięci w xdebug pokazuje mi:
ilosc zuzytej pamieci 2 211 608 bajtów, największe zużycie pamięci 2 698 404 ilosc zuzytej pamieci 1 284 664 bajtów, największe zużycie pamięci 1 743 376 ilosc zuzytej pamieci 1 475 540 bajtów, największe zużycie pamięci 1 965 500 Kod jest pisany strukturalnie i zastanawiam się jakiego profilera można użyć albo jak inaczej sprawdzić gdzie jest największe obciążenie. Nie mam dostępu do php.ini wiec nie ustawie profilowania z xdebuger, lokalnie skrypt nie bedzie dzialal. Możecie podesłać mi parę rad jak się do tego zabrać ? -------------------- |
|
|
![]()
Post
#2
|
|
![]() Grupa: Moderatorzy Postów: 15 467 Pomógł: 1451 Dołączył: 25.04.2005 Skąd: Szczebrzeszyn/Rzeszów ![]() |
Sprawdzasz zużycie pamięci rejestrując funkcję odpalaną co "tick".
A najlepiej by było profilerem. Cytat ilosc zuzytej pamieci 2 211 608 bajtów, największe zużycie pamięci 2 698 404 Malutko. ![]() -------------------- ![]() ZCE :: Pisząc PW załączaj LINK DO TEMATU i TYLKO w sprawach moderacji :: jakiś błąd - a TREŚĆ BŁĘDU? :: nie ponaglaj z odpowiedzią via PW! |
|
|
![]()
Post
#3
|
|
![]() Grupa: Zarejestrowani Postów: 1 366 Pomógł: 261 Dołączył: 23.09.2008 Skąd: Bydgoszcz Ostrzeżenie: (0%) ![]() ![]() |
xDebug + webgrind do odczytania wygenerowanych logów i prześledź całość
![]() -------------------- |
|
|
![]()
Post
#4
|
|
Grupa: Zarejestrowani Postów: 384 Pomógł: 13 Dołączył: 16.06.2006 Ostrzeżenie: (0%) ![]() ![]() |
Skrypt uruchamia się w cronie co minutę. Mówicie że malutko pożera pamięci ?
Od hostingu dostałem info, że pochłaniam ogromnie dużo ramu, w takim razie może to nie ten skrypt muszę zoptymalizować... wydawał mi się najcięższy odnośnie ram. W takim razie jak znaleźć cięższy ? Tak jak mówiłem nie mam dostępu do php.ini więc nie mogę profilować xdebug'iem Cytat odpalaną co "tick". Nie rozumiem? Ten post edytował Agape 28.05.2011, 16:11:10 -------------------- |
|
|
![]()
Post
#5
|
|
![]() Grupa: Moderatorzy Postów: 15 467 Pomógł: 1451 Dołączył: 25.04.2005 Skąd: Szczebrzeszyn/Rzeszów ![]() |
Cytat Skrypt uruchamia się w cronie co minutę. Mówicie że malutko pożera pamięci ? 3 MiB/skrypt, to jest mało. Cytat Nie rozumiem? http://tinyurl.com/42jxmx7 ![]() -------------------- ![]() ZCE :: Pisząc PW załączaj LINK DO TEMATU i TYLKO w sprawach moderacji :: jakiś błąd - a TREŚĆ BŁĘDU? :: nie ponaglaj z odpowiedzią via PW! |
|
|
![]()
Post
#6
|
|
![]() Grupa: Zarejestrowani Postów: 235 Pomógł: 17 Dołączył: 18.07.2007 Skąd: Białystok Ostrzeżenie: (0%) ![]() ![]() |
Może na początek poprostu go przeanalizować bez profilera ?
PS. można też zmienić hosting ![]() |
|
|
![]()
Post
#7
|
|
Grupa: Zarejestrowani Postów: 384 Pomógł: 13 Dołączył: 16.06.2006 Ostrzeżenie: (0%) ![]() ![]() |
Problem rozwiązany i okazał się być zupełnie gdzie indziej. Za duża baza danych się nagromadziła. Mimo wszystko dzięki za całą wiedzę jaką nabyłem dzięki wam
![]() -------------------- |
|
|
![]() ![]() |
![]() |
Wersja Lo-Fi | Aktualny czas: 14.08.2025 - 12:00 |